What Is a Body and Soul Retreat?
A body and soul retreat is an immersive experience that focuses on restoring physical vitality and mental clarity while nurturing emotional and spiritual health. Unlike a standard vacation, retreats are intentional: they are structured around activities that reduce stress, enhance mindfulness, and improve overall wellness.
Core Principles:
-
Mind-body connection: Understanding how physical health influences mental and emotional well-being.
-
Holistic healing: Integrating physical activities, nutrition, creative practices, and meditation.
-
Self-reflection: Offering time and space to reconnect with personal goals and inner balance.
Retreats can be weekend-long or last several weeks, often set in serene natural environments such as beaches, mountains, or forests. This immersion encourages participants to slow down and focus on themselves.

10 Essential Activities You’ll Find at a Body and Soul Retreat
1. Yoga and Mindful Movement
Yoga is often the cornerstone of a body and soul retreat. Classes are tailored to all skill levels and focus on:
-
Stretching and strengthening the body
-
Reducing stress through breathwork
-
Promoting mind-body awareness
Many retreats also include gentle movement practices such as Tai Chi, Qigong, or dance therapy, which enhance physical alignment and energy flow.
2. Guided Meditation Sessions
Meditation helps calm the mind, improve focus, and develop mindfulness. Sessions can include:
-
Breathwork techniques
-
Loving-kindness meditation
Regular practice during the retreat helps participants feel grounded and centered.
3. Nutrition Workshops and Clean Eating Programs
A balanced diet is essential for physical and mental health. Retreats often include:
-
Nutritional guidance
-
Cooking classes with wholesome ingredients
-
Detox programs tailored to individual needs
These activities educate participants on how to nourish the body to support healing and energy.
4. Nature Immersion and Outdoor Activities
Being in nature is healing for both mind and body. Activities may include:
-
Forest bathing or guided nature walks
-
Beach yoga or sunrise meditation
-
Outdoor journaling or reflective exercises
Exposure to natural settings reduces stress and promotes mental clarity.
5. Holistic Healing and Therapeutic Practices
Many retreats incorporate complementary therapies such as:
-
Massage therapy
-
Acupuncture
-
Reiki or energy healing
-
Sound therapy
These approaches support physical relaxation and emotional release.
6. Creative Expression and Art Therapy
Artistic activities foster self-expression and emotional exploration. Common practices include:
-
Painting or drawing
-
Journaling and poetry
-
Music therapy or movement-based expression
These activities allow participants to process emotions in a non-verbal and safe way.
7. Mind-Body Workshops
Mind-body workshops often combine scientific and spiritual approaches to wellness. Topics include:
-
Stress management techniques
-
Emotional intelligence and self-awareness
-
Breathwork and somatic exercises
Workshops encourage practical skills that can be applied beyond the retreat.
8. Group Sharing Circles
Sharing circles provide a safe space for participants to express thoughts and feelings. Benefits include:
-
Validation of experiences
-
Building supportive connections
-
Accelerated emotional healing
Being part of a supportive community helps individuals feel less isolated in their journey.
9. Silent Reflection and Mindfulness Time
Many retreats offer periods of silence for self-reflection. Activities include:
-
Silent walks
-
Journaling sessions
This quiet time enhances introspection, clarity, and inner peace.
10. Personalized Coaching and One-on-One Support
Some retreats offer one-on-one sessions with:
-
Life coaches
-
Therapists
-
Wellness practitioners
This individualized support ensures that participants’ unique needs are addressed.

FAQs
1. What exactly happens at a body and soul retreat?
A body and soul retreat combines yoga, meditation, nutrition workshops, nature activities, and creative or therapeutic practices designed to restore balance to your body, mind, and spirit.
2. Do I need prior experience with yoga or meditation to join a retreat?
Not at all. Most retreats cater to all levels, offering beginner-friendly yoga and guided meditation sessions alongside advanced options for experienced participants.
3. How long do body and soul retreats usually last?
They can range from weekend getaways to week-long or multi-week programs, depending on your goals and schedule.
4. Can I attend a retreat alone, or do I need to go with a group?
Both options work. Solo travelers often enjoy self-reflection and personal growth, while group retreats provide community, accountability, and shared experiences.
5. What should I bring to a retreat?
Comfortable clothing for yoga and movement, a journal, water bottle, personal toiletries, and anything that helps you disconnect from daily distractions. Some retreats may provide mats or supplies.
